St. William of York, Reading

Masses at St. William of York, Reading

  • Latin Mass every Sunday at 11.00 am.
  • Latin Mass every Holy Day at 12 noon.

at St. William of York, Upper Redlands Road, Reading.

Low / Sung Mass at the Church of the Sacred Heart, Fareham

On the First Saturday of every month at 9.30am.
The Church of the Sacred Heart, 43 Portland Street, Fareham, Hampshire
